What Is 3-Hydroxybenzoic acid?

Section Link

3-Hydroxybenzoic acid is a solid substance that can be found in fruits and the gut. It is also isolated from plants like Taxus baccata and Citrus paradisi. When used in cosmetics, it functions to condition the skin. Additionally, it is used in the production of glycol benzoates for plasticizers and as a rubber polymerization activator or retardant.

What is the purpose of 3-Hydroxybenzoic acid in personal care products? It is used for its skin conditioning characteristics. 3-Hydroxybenzoic acid moisturizes and strengthens skin.

What Are Skin Conditioning Ingredients?

Section Link

3-Hydroxybenzoic acid has skin conditioning characteristics.

Skin conditioning ingredients improve the texture, feel, and overall appearance of the skin, helping to avoid harmful effects from external factors. Skin conditioning ingredients moisturize the skin and strengthen its natural barrier function to help protect it from damage caused by harsh weather and sunlight. Some skin conditioning ingredients are anti-inflammatory and can help reduce redness and irritated skin.
